2. pH Steadiness
The pH steadiness of insect residue removing options is a vital issue figuring out their efficacy and potential influence on a automobile’s floor. Options that deviate considerably from a impartial pH can pose dangers to the paint, clear coat, and different supplies.
-
Acidity and Etching
Extremely acidic options (low pH) can aggressively dissolve bug stays however concurrently etch into the automobile’s clear coat. This etching ends in everlasting blemishes and dullness that requires skilled sharpening or paint correction. The severity of etching relies on the acid focus and the period of publicity. Examples embody formulations containing robust acids like hydrochloric or sulfuric acid, which, whereas efficient at dissolving natural matter, pose vital dangers.
-
Alkalinity and Injury
Extremely alkaline options (excessive pH) may also be detrimental. Whereas not as straight corrosive as acidic options, alkaline cleaners can strip wax coatings and degrade sure plastics and rubber parts. This weakens the protecting barrier supplied by wax, leaving the paint weak to environmental contaminants and UV injury. An instance is the usage of concentrated alkaline detergents, which successfully take away grease and dirt however can go away surfaces unprotected.
-
Impartial pH Benefit
pH-neutral or near-neutral options (pH round 7) supply a balanced method. These formulations are designed to dissolve insect residue with out inflicting vital injury to the automobile’s surfaces. Whereas they might require barely extra dwell time or agitation, they mitigate the chance of etching, discoloration, or stripping of protecting coatings. Most commercially out there, devoted bug removers are formulated to be pH impartial or barely alkaline to keep away from injury.
-
Buffering Brokers
Many formulations incorporate buffering brokers to take care of a constant pH degree, even when uncovered to environmental elements or diluted. Buffering brokers forestall drastic shifts in pH that would compromise the answer’s security or efficacy. These brokers stabilize the pH, guaranteeing constant efficiency and minimizing the chance of unintended injury. For instance, an answer with added buffers will resist turning into extra acidic when uncovered to acidic bug stays, sustaining its pH and protecting properties.
In the end, the collection of an insect residue removing resolution with a balanced pH is important for long-term automobile care. Issues ought to embody the answer’s formulation, the automobile’s floor supplies, and the applying surroundings. Common use of pH-balanced options minimizes the chance of harm whereas successfully eradicating ugly bug stays, preserving the automobile’s look.
3. Floor Compatibility
The collection of an applicable insect residue removing product is basically linked to its compatibility with numerous automotive surfaces. A product’s efficacy in dissolving bug stays is secondary to its potential influence on the automobile’s paint, trim, and different supplies. Subsequently, understanding floor compatibility is paramount when selecting the optimum cleansing resolution.
-
Paint Finishes
Trendy automotive paints encompass a number of layers, together with a transparent coat designed to guard the bottom coloration. Aggressive solvents or abrasive brokers can injury this clear coat, resulting in oxidation, fading, and a discount in gloss. As an illustration, a product containing harsh degreasers might successfully take away bug splatter however concurrently strip away protecting wax or sealant layers, rendering the paint vulnerable to environmental injury. Consideration have to be given as to whether the product is protected to be used on numerous paint sorts, together with clear coats, single-stage paints, and matte finishes.
-
Plastic and Trim
Exterior plastic trim, together with bumpers, moldings, and mirror housings, is usually manufactured from numerous polymers delicate to sure chemical compounds. Publicity to unsuitable cleansing brokers may cause discoloration, cracking, or clouding. For instance, a product with excessive concentrations of alcohol might successfully clear painted surfaces however can dry out and injury plastic parts, resulting in untimely getting old and discoloration. Product labels ought to point out compatibility with various kinds of plastics generally discovered on autos.
-
Glass and Mirrors
Whereas glass and mirrors are usually extra proof against chemical injury than paint or plastic, sure cleansing brokers can go away streaks or residue, impairing visibility. Moreover, some merchandise might comprise abrasive particles that may scratch glass surfaces, notably if the glass has pre-existing imperfections. Collection of a product particularly formulated for automotive glass is advisable to keep away from these points, guaranteeing a transparent and streak-free end.
-
Metallic Surfaces
Uncovered metallic surfaces, reminiscent of chrome trim or aluminum wheels, additionally require cautious consideration. Some cleansing brokers can promote corrosion or trigger pitting on these surfaces, particularly if the protecting coatings are compromised. For instance, utilizing a product containing robust acids on aluminum wheels can lead to speedy corrosion and discoloration. Deciding on a product with corrosion inhibitors is crucial for safeguarding metallic parts.
In the end, the perfect insect residue removing resolution should reveal broad floor compatibility, successfully cleansing bug stays with out inflicting injury to any automobile element. The cautious collection of a product primarily based on its formulation and meant use is essential for preserving the automobile’s aesthetic look and stopping long-term injury.

5. Residue Removing
The effectiveness of any insect residue removing product hinges not solely on its capacity to dissolve insect stays but in addition on the convenience and completeness with which the ensuing residue might be faraway from the automobile’s floor. Full residue removing is important to forestall streaking, recognizing, and the re-deposition of dissolved contaminants, thereby influencing the general end high quality and longevity of protecting coatings.
-
Surfactant Motion and Lifting
The presence and efficacy of surfactants within the product’s formulation considerably have an effect on residue removing. Surfactants scale back floor stress, permitting the cleansing resolution to penetrate and carry insect particles from the substrate. Insufficient surfactant motion can lead to a skinny movie of residue remaining on the floor, attracting dust and diminishing gloss. An instance contains merchandise that rely solely on solvent motion, which can dissolve the bug stays however lack the power to carry the dissolved matter successfully, resulting in re-deposition upon drying.
-
Wiping Method and Materials
The method employed throughout wiping, in addition to the fabric used, performs a important position in full residue removing. Abrasive supplies or extreme strain can induce scratches, whereas insufficient wiping can go away behind streaks and uneven surfaces. Microfiber cloths, identified for his or her comfortable texture and absorbent properties, are usually most well-liked over paper towels or cotton rags. The selection of wiping method, reminiscent of overlapping strokes or a two-cloth technique (one for preliminary removing, one for closing buffing), additional influences the end result. For instance, using a round wiping movement can result in seen swirl marks, notably on dark-colored autos.
-
Rinsing Effectiveness
For sure formulations, rinsing with water is a needed step in residue removing. Rinsing eliminates any remaining cleansing resolution and dissolved contaminants, stopping recognizing and streaking. The effectiveness of rinsing relies on water high quality and strain. Onerous water, with excessive mineral content material, can go away behind water spots, whereas inadequate water strain might not completely take away the residue. A closing wipe with a clear microfiber fabric after rinsing is usually advisable to make sure a spot-free end.
-
Product Compatibility with Coatings
The interplay between the residue removing product and any pre-existing protecting coatings, reminiscent of waxes or sealants, have to be thought-about. Some merchandise might strip these coatings, lowering their effectiveness and leaving the paint weak. Residue from these merchandise may also intrude with the bonding of subsequently utilized coatings. Formulations particularly designed to be “wax-safe” or “coating-friendly” decrease this threat, guaranteeing compatibility with numerous automotive floor remedies.
In conclusion, efficient residue removing is an indispensable side of utilizing any insect residue removing product. The interaction between the product’s formulation, utility method, rinsing (if relevant), and compatibility with current coatings determines the standard and longevity of the achieved end. Consequently, when evaluating totally different “greatest bug remover from automobiles” options, meticulous consideration have to be paid to their residue removing properties and advisable procedures.

Important Suggestions for Efficient Insect Residue Removing
The following pointers present important methods for maximizing the effectiveness of insect residue removing efforts whereas minimizing the potential for injury to automotive surfaces.
Tip 1: Pre-Soak Affected Areas. Previous to making use of any cleansing resolution, completely saturate the affected areas with water. This pre-soaking course of helps to loosen dried insect stays, facilitating their subsequent removing.
Tip 2: Apply the Cleansing Answer in a Shaded Space. Direct daylight can speed up the drying means of cleansing options, resulting in streaking and uneven removing. Making use of the answer in a shaded space minimizes this threat.
Tip 3: Make the most of a Microfiber Material for Mild Wiping. Microfiber cloths supply a comfortable, non-abrasive floor that minimizes the chance of scratching the automobile’s paint. Make use of mild, overlapping strokes to keep away from swirl marks.
Tip 4: Observe Beneficial Dwell Occasions. Adhere strictly to the producer’s advisable dwell occasions for the cleansing resolution. Permitting the answer to dwell for an inadequate period might hinder its effectiveness, whereas extreme dwell occasions can improve the chance of floor injury.
Tip 5: Rinse Completely with Clear Water. After making use of and dwelling the cleansing resolution, rinse the affected areas completely with clear water to take away any residual product. Be certain that all surfaces are utterly freed from residue earlier than drying.
Tip 6: Examine for Cussed Residue and Repeat as Vital. After preliminary cleansing, rigorously examine the handled areas for any remaining insect residue. Repeat the cleansing course of as wanted, specializing in notably cussed areas.
Tip 7: Apply a Protecting Wax or Sealant. Following insect residue removing, apply a protecting wax or sealant coating to create a hydrophobic barrier and decrease future insect adhesion. This step helps to protect the automobile’s end and scale back the frequency of required cleansing.
The constant utility of those strategies ensures optimum insect residue removing and safety of automotive surfaces. The advantages embody improved automobile aesthetics, decreased threat of long-term paint injury, and minimized upkeep necessities.
